I have noticed deer in this sand pit for years and thought I would put my Cuddeback out to capture the deer. When I first found this area it was about 5 feet around, now it is about 10 x 20 feet. My family has started to call the pit mystery sand. The sand has some mineral to attract the deer as you can see.

I took various pictures of this strange buck during the 05' hunting season. He has a typical rack on one side and one long protruding point on the other. The sword like point is approximately 14 long. The other two pictures are just nice heavy beamed Nebraska bucks.
